Table 2.

Summary of variant fibrinogens and their functions


Fibrinogen

Substitution

Allele*

Fibrin polymerization

FpA release

FpB release

FXIIIa-catalyzed cross-linking

References
Kyoto I   γN308K   Hetero   AMn  N   N (5.0/1.0)   ND   Yoshida et al24  
Bicetre II   γN308K   Hetero   AMn  ND   ND   A   Grailhe et al25  
        Marchi et al51  
Matsumoto II   γN308K   Hetero   ATh  ND   ND   ND   Okumura et al23,27  
γK308   γN308K   Recomb   ATh  N   A (0.1/0.005)   A   Okumura et al27  
Baltimore III   γN308I   Hetero   AMn  N   N (4.0/0.33)   ND   Bantia et al22  
        Ebert and Bell50  
γI308   γN308I   Recomb   ATh/NTh§  N   A/N (0.1/0.005)§  N   This paper  
Matsumoto I   γD364H   Hetero   ATh  N   N (1.0/0.2)   ND   Hogan et al26  
        Okumura et al29  
γH364   γD364H   Recomb   ATh  N   N (0.09/0.01)  ND   Hogan et al26  
        Okumura et al49  
Vlissingen/Frankfurt IV   γΔ19N,320D   Hetero   AMn  N   N (4.0/2.0)   ND   Hogan et al26  
        Koopman et al40  
γΔ319,320
 
γD319N,320D
 
Recomb
 
ATh
 
N
 
A (0.1/0.01)
 
A
 
Hogan et al26,39
